Describe the effects of bioaccumulation and biomagnification.
- Some effects that can occur in an ecosystem when a persistent substance is biomagnified in a food chain include eggshell thinning and developmental deformities in top carnivores of the higher trophic levels.
- Humans also experience harmful effects from biomagnification, including issues with the reproductive, nervous, and circulatory systems.
- DDT, mercury, and PCBs are substances that bioaccumulate and have significant environmental impacts.
